A Study on Impact of Dividend Policy on Initial Public Offering Price Performance

: This study examines the impact of dividend policy on the performance of initial public offering in India. The period of study is from the year 2011-2014. Monthly returns of the IPOs issued in the considered period and Indian Stock Market Index (Nifty 50) was considered for the long-run performance study. The methodological tools used are long-run performance statistics and garch model. ‘Dummy’ variable was used to measure the effect of dividends on the IPOs. The study reveals that the…
